Market Overview and Key Drivers

Smart parking solutions include sensor-based systems, automated ticketing, mobile payment platforms, and cloud-based monitoring. These systems are designed to help drivers locate available parking spaces quickly, reduce search time, and minimize carbon emissions caused by vehicles circling for parking. With increasing urbanization and limited parking infrastructure, smart parking systems have become essential for city planners, commercial establishments, and residential complexes.

Key market drivers include rising traffic congestion in metropolitan areas, growing adoption of smart city initiatives, and technological advancements in IoT, AI, and cloud computing. Integration with mobile apps and navigation systems allows real-time updates on parking availability, dynamic pricing, and automated reservation, enhancing user convenience and operational efficiency. Moreover, governments across North America, Europe, and Asia-Pacific are promoting smart parking adoption as part of broader initiatives to improve traffic management and reduce environmental impacts.

Technological Advancements Shaping the Market

Innovation in smart parking technology is a major factor driving market growth. IoT-enabled sensors and cameras provide real-time data on parking occupancy, while AI and machine learning algorithms optimize parking allocation and predict demand patterns. Mobile applications allow drivers to check availability, reserve spaces, and make seamless payments, eliminating the need for physical tickets and reducing congestion at entry points.

Automated parking systems, such as robotic valet parking, are gaining traction in premium commercial and residential properties. These systems enhance space utilization, reduce human error, and allow for multi-level parking in limited spaces. Additionally, integration with electric vehicle charging infrastructure ensures that smart parking facilities support the growing adoption of EVs, creating a holistic solution for modern urban mobility.

Regional Insights and Market Dynamics

The smart parking market is expanding rapidly in Asia-Pacific, North America, and Europe. Asia-Pacific dominates due to rapid urbanization, increasing vehicle ownership, and government-led smart city projects in countries like China and India. North America focuses on technological innovations and integration with urban infrastructure, while Europe emphasizes sustainability and energy-efficient smart parking solutions.

Market dynamics include increasing public-private partnerships, rising demand for automated parking solutions, and growing awareness of environmental benefits. However, challenges such as high initial installation costs, maintenance requirements, and integration with existing infrastructure can limit adoption in some regions. Companies are addressing these barriers through scalable, modular solutions and cost-effective deployment strategies.
